Cream sugar and butter; add eggs.
Add milk and soda mixture alternately with sifted flour and nutmeg.
Add vanilla.
Roll out not too thin; cut with cookie cutter.
Bake in 350Β° oven until just done, but not too brown.
May be iced or sprinkled with sugar, if desired.
Add 1/2 teaspoon salt if Crisco is used instead of butter.
